So many March themes to work with... the return of Daylight Savings, Fat Tuesday, St Patrick's Day, the Ides. An event at a local Wethersfield watering hole, Humphrey's, seems a great way to recognize the gradual return of long sunshiny days, Mardis Gras, the Luck of the Irish and, for that matter, the good fortune that cachers rely on. (Let's disregard the Shakespeare reference, eh?)
A keen eye and sharp mind may go a long way toward successful caching, but so does luck. Indeed, so many of us have been fortunate to get an introduction thru caching to a great new spot, a FTF or the thrill of a really tough find... and most have been unlucky to get skunked by a hide that's been muggled, iced / snowed over or so cleverly camo'd that it bests us.
So, on this second Tuesday, lets raise a glass to March and all the harbingers of hope and luck that it brings! We'll be there by 6:30, tho you can come when suits you. And who knows? Maybe at the 66th CCC you'll get lucky in a raffle...
The Central Connecticut Cacher’s Nite Out is an evening gathering on the 2nd Tuesday of most months. Anyone and everyone is welcome to attend...you don't have to reside in CT, and you certainly don't have to be an experienced cacher...new folks are most welcome! Let us know if this is your first event as we'd like to get acquainted. This event features new or rotating hosts every month, and changing locations. If you have an interest in hosting, please contact KD&MS. As host, you’ll select a location; get the coordinates; and copy and paste the event page and resubmit. There are a number of places in the Greater Hartford area to enjoy good food and drinks. Locations should be kid friendly, have no admission fee and be within the Central Connecticut/Greater Hartford area. Cachers from outside of the area are also encouraged to host, but we do ask that the event itself be held in the central CT area.
